Post Plugin v1.19
This is a fix for the problem faced by Roubal during animation exports, and may not be required for people doing stills and/or not facing exact same issue as Roubal did, as you may have to adapt your workflow.

What has changed:
- the "Selection only" option is now ignored, you have to use one of the two others if you don't want to export all objects
- all layers are now exported, instead of only visible ones (this is required in order to have the fix working)
- the "Fly" animation button is back, exporting first frame and then only updating camera and sun for subsequent ones

Requirements should be same as for v1.17 (recent 2.63 builds).
